Recovery Haze Strain Overview
Recovery Haze is a sativa-dominant cannabis strain developed in the early 2010s by breeders seeking to create a functional, uplifting strain with therapeutic potential. The strain emerged from the medical cannabis community in California, where breeders crossed a classic Haze variety with a high-CBD strain to create a balanced profile that maintains sativa characteristics while offering potential wellness benefits. Its development was specifically aimed at providing relief without heavy sedation, making it suitable for daytime use.
The strain produces medium to large-sized buds with a distinctive appearance featuring elongated, spear-shaped colas covered in a generous layer of trichomes. The flowers typically display a vibrant green color with occasional purple hues that emerge under cooler growing conditions, complemented by bright orange pistils. Recovery Haze is noted for its relatively fast flowering time compared to traditional Haze varieties, which often require extended maturation periods.
Recovery Haze has gained recognition for its balanced effects that combine cerebral stimulation with physical relaxation. The strain's name reflects its reported ability to help users recover from fatigue, stress, and minor discomfort while maintaining mental clarity. It has become particularly popular among medical cannabis patients and those seeking functional relief during daytime activities, though it remains less common in mainstream recreational markets than more established Haze varieties.

Recovery Haze Strain Growing Information
Recovery Haze is considered a moderate-difficulty strain to cultivate, suitable for growers with some experience. The plants typically flower in 9-11 weeks indoors and are ready for harvest by mid-October outdoors in northern hemisphere climates. Indoor yields average 400-500 grams per square meter, while outdoor plants can produce 500-700 grams per plant under optimal conditions. The strain prefers a warm, Mediterranean-like climate with plenty of sunlight when grown outdoors, though it can adapt to various environments. Plants tend to stretch significantly during the flowering phase, reaching heights of 150-200 cm indoors and up to 250 cm outdoors, requiring adequate vertical space and possibly training techniques. Recovery Haze responds well to both soil and hydroponic growing methods and benefits from proper nutrient management, particularly during the flowering stage.
